ALBANY, N.Y. – The UAlbany men’s lacrosse team is calling for people to support team JP, running for JP Honsinger, in the upcoming Superhero Sprint 5K on campus.
The Superhero Sprint 5K will be run on Saturday, November 8th on the UAlbany campus, held by the Department of Residential Life with proceeds to benefit the Starlight Children’s Foundation.  Registration opens at 8:30 a.m. with the walk/run beginning at 10 a.m.  Those participating are encouraged to wear their favorite superhero costumes.
Team JP will run in support of JP Honsinger, an 11-year-old who is suffering from Niemann-Pick Type C Disease, a form of childhood Alzheimer’s.  JP has spent time at practice and at games with the UAlbany men’s lacrosse team.
Registration is just $10 for UAlbany students and staff.
